I introduced you to electro-pop quartet, The Pass, last month, to a great response, something that’s always exciting when dealing with a brand new band. Now The Pass are offering up the title track from their Colors EP for you all to download.

“Colors”, instantly likable and kinetic, is cut from the same A-Grade cloth of indie pop that made Wolfgang Amadeus Phoenix one of the late ’00s most memorable records. You can listen to and download “Colors” below, and make sure you also have the Pass’ debut single “Crosswalk Stereo”, which you can download for free right here.
